Major Accountabilities Of Position:
- Provide advice to the project on aspects relating to legal and commercial transactions.
- Formulation, preparation and issue of site works tenders.
- Negotiate Contracts with Contractors with acceptable commercial risk in accordance with Company and Client Policy.
- Ensure that contracts/subcontracts are let with acceptable commercial risks and also in accordance with Company and Client policy.
- Administer site works contracts throughout the course of the Project.

Liaise with Project Management, Construction Management, Engineering and Controls to achieve satisfactory completion of contracts on time and within budget.
